Early Days: Baggy Silhouettes and Anti-Fashion Rebellion (2017-2019)

Billie Eilish burst onto the scene in 2017 with oversized hoodies, graphic tees, and a streetwear aesthetic that felt worlds away from polished pop stars. Her early style was deliberate armor. “I only started wearing baggy clothes because of my body,” she later shared, highlighting her desire to avoid objectification.

This period defined her as a rule-breaker. Neon green and black hair roots, cartoon-inspired pieces like Powerpuff Girls tops, and graffiti-laden jackets became signatures. She mixed high and low: Louis Vuitton logos with everyday comfort. It resonated deeply with teens navigating body image pressures.

The 2020 American Vogue Breakthrough

Her March 2020 American Vogue cover marked a milestone. Vogue commissioned multiple unique covers featuring Billie in Gucci, Versace, and Prada. One standout showed her in a bold Prada Linea Rossa jacket and pants paired with Nike sneakers, blending athletic edge with luxury.

The 2021 Transformation: British Vogue and Body Positivity

The June 2021 British Vogue cover remains one of her most talked-about moments. Billie ditched the baggy layers for a pin-up inspired look with corsets, lingerie touches, and soft blonde hair. Photographed by Craig McDean, she channeled classic Hollywood glamour while staying true to herself.

This shift sparked global conversation. Fans celebrated her embracing curves, but Billie addressed the backlash head-on. She emphasized that changing styles didn’t mean changing her values. It was about feeling good, not seeking approval.

Mid-Career Refinement: Met Galas, Red Carpets, and Signature Blends (2022-2023)

Post-2021, Billie balanced her roots with high fashion. She wore Simone Rocha dresses, Gucci ensembles, and Thom Browne tailoring. The 2021 Met Gala saw her in Oscar de la Renta, while later appearances mixed Rick Owens with sporty elements.

Her style became more versatile: oversized suits, sailor-inspired Prada, and custom pieces that allowed movement for performances. This era showed growth without losing authenticity. She continued favoring comfort, like cargo shorts and hoodies off-duty, proving evolution means addition, not erasure.

Recent Vogue Covers: Maturity and Playfulness (2024-2025)

The November 2024 American Vogue cover captured Billie as a grown artist. Styled by Ib Kamara and shot by Mikael Jansson, she appeared in tailored Gucci suits, Bottega Veneta pieces, and thoughtful accessories. It highlighted discipline, touring life, and self-reflection.

In 2025, her British Vogue cover continued the elemental, artistic theme, blending classic and contemporary labels. These Billie Eilish Vogue features show confidence in tailoring and femininity on her terms.

She prioritizes flexibility for stage energy while experimenting with brooches, ties, and layered looks. Her hair evolutions, from neon to blonde to natural, mirror these style shifts.
